Shopping

There are various interesting shops in the area worth exploring for several hours on days of strong winds or low temperatures. The scope of shops varies from sports and recreation to interior décor, local delicatessen, leather and skin products, and handicraft. This is an excellent place to find gifts for your nearest and dearest. You can find shops in Vemdalen village, Vemdalsskalet, Klövsjö, Hede and Åsarna. Spa, massage & swimming

Swimming is fun for everyone, adults as well as the children. Storhogna Högfjällshotell & Spa has a swimming pool and jacuzzi in scenic setting in the delightful winter garden; a brilliant choice for all the family members. Furthermore, the fine spa-section tempts with energizing treatments, hot sauna, refreshing pool and jacuzzi. You can visit their web site for more information about opening hours and booking.

At Vemdalsskalet, in the middle of the Skalet square is a naprapathy surgery where you can book a treatment; after a few days of skiing you may need help to soften the muscles in your legs, back and neck in order to cope with the rest of your holiday. Open all year round.

 

Cinema

At GT-gården, in the middle of Vemdalen Village is a cosy 1950s style cinema, albeit boasting the latest technology. It uses state-of-the-art digital technology and is thus able to screen the most recent films. One bonus is the interlude – whatever the length of the film – a popular time for mingling, and the consumption of popcorn and coffee in the foyer. Only winter time.

 

Bowling

There are two bowling facilities in the area, both complemented with restaurants and bars so you can combine bowling with a good dinner, before or after. Besides bowling you can also engage in dart, table tennis and billiards. One facility is located in Vemdalen village and the other one in Storhogna. Winter season: Après-ski & Nightlife

Vemdalen presents a wide selection of restaurants, on-slope eateries and hotels offering events and après-ski throughout the winter season. Select the type of après-ski that suits you best: a quiet drink in the winter garden to relax after a day on the slopes or a loud and hot beer session with a band playing live on stage. Most weekends at Vemdalsskalets Högfjällshotell there is a nightclub with live bands, DJs and several bars.
